About this app

The Radiacode is a portable radiation dosimeter that uses a highly sensitive scintillation detector for analyzing environmental radiation levels in real-time.

The dosimeter can be operated in one of three ways: autonomously, through a smartphone app (via Bluetooth or USB), or through PC software (via USB).

In all operation modes, Radiacode:

- Measures current dose rate levels of gamma and X-ray radiation and can display the data in numerical values, or as a graph;
- Calculates and displays the cumulative dose of the gamma and X-ray radiation;
- Calculates and displays the cumulative radiation energy spectrum;
- Signals when dose rate or cumulative radiation dose exceeds thresholds set by a user;
- Continuously stores the above data in non-volatile memory;
- While under the app control, it continuously streams the data to the control gadget for real-time indication and storing it in database.

The app allows:

- Setting Radiacode parameters;
- Displaying all types of measurement results;
- Storing the measurement results in the database with time stamps and location tags;
- Tracking the route data points on Google Maps and displaying them with the dose rate color tags.

In demo mode, the app works with a virtual device. This gives you the opportunity to familiarize yourself with the app before you purchase the device.

Radiacode indicators:

- LCD
- LEDs
- alarm sound
- vibration

Controls: 3 buttons.
Power supply: built-in 1000 mAh Li-pol battery.
Run time: > 10 days.

Compatible with devices Radiacode 10X
